Ich habe eine Menge Zeit damit verbracht, eine benutzerdefinierte Sammlung einer benutzerdefinierten Klasse zu den Anwendungseinstellungen meines winforms-Projekts hinzuzufügen. Ich habe das Gefühl, dass ich es auf sechs verschiedene Arten ausprobiert habe, einschließlich dieser Weg , dieser Weg , auf diese Weise und so aber nichts scheint zu funktionieren ...
Derzeit entspricht der Code und läuft gut - keine Ausnahmen überall. Code seine Save-Funktion, aber keine Einträge in der Einstellungen XML-Datei erstellt (ich habe ein paar andere Einstellungen und es funktioniert für alle von ihnen, aber diese eine FYI). Wenn es geladen wird, ist Properties.Settings.Default.LastSearches
immer Null ... Irgendwelche Gedanken?
Hier ist mein aktueller Code:
Die Klassen:
%Vor%Schreiben in Einstellungen:
%Vor%Laden von Einstellungen
%Vor%Tags und Links c# .net-4.0 winforms serialization settings